When will I be notified of the decision? The Office of Student Financial Services (OSFS) will notify endowed scholarship applicants by the end of May.

Students who are registered for summer courses at Emmanuel must have their balance paid in full before the start of class. Although Emmanuel College does not offer financial aid for the summer, we encourage you to meet with the OSFS to discuss your payment options, including private student and parent loans.
